Silicon carbide fibers are used to evaluate fuel temperatures within an optical procedure termed thin-filament pyrometry. It entails the placement of a skinny filament inside of a warm fuel stream. Radiative emissions within the filament can be correlated with filament temperature.

Silicon carbide can host point defects from the crystal lattice, which can be often called shade facilities. These defects can generate one photons on demand and thus function a System for one-photon source.
